Check out the files contained within the repository to the testing directory. Older releases are available from the archive download site. How to install apache svn on linux mint 19 linux mint 18. Are there any benefits to running subversion server on linux. Aug 20, 2015 introduction to collabnet svn collabnet subversion edge includes everything you need to install, manage and operate a subversion server. Download the psychtoolbox installer to your desktop. Tortoisesvn is an apache subversion svn client, implemented as a windows shell extension. Subversion svn is an open source version controling system. Here we will install apache server as a web server for the svn repository. Subversion exists to be universally recognized and adopted as an opensource, centralized version control system characterized by its reliability as a safe haven for valuable data, the simplicity.
Subversion exists to be universally recognized and adopted as an opensource, centralized version control system characterized by its reliability as a safe. This is a simple standalone server which uses ssh security. Install the collabnet subversion client before the collabnet subversion server. Subversion for red hat linux free download and software. It can also be applied to any other types of files or purpose i. This chapter describes how to install and configure subversion for version control.
The following are the currently supported versions of subversion. This package includes the subversion client svn, svnsync, repository administration tools svnadmin, svnlook and a network server svnserve. Found this question answered here based on the tortoisesvn lead. Are there any benefits to running subversion server on. Subversion is a change management cm system for software source code configuration control. On x64 versions of windows 7 and 8, the tortoisesvn context menu and overlays wont show for 32bit applications in their fileopensave dialogs until you install the 2017 cruntime for x86. It is developed and distributed by the apache software foundation asf. Any time you change, add or delete a file or folder that you control with subversion, you commit these changes to the subversion repository, which creates a new revision in the repository reflecting these changes.
You can always go back, look at and get the contents of. Please make sure that you choose the right installer for your pc, otherwise the setup. Install apache svn on linux mint 19 apache svn revision 0. Installing and configuring apache subversion on linux ubuntu. I do not need to work with svn after this, i just need to download all the files onto my system in one go instead of right. Open the my computer icon it is either on the desktop or in the start menu. Most subcommands take file andor directory arguments. Visualsvn is intended to be installed on workstations used by software developers. Check out the files contained within the repository to the testing directory, create a directory called svncheckout. Subversion, widely known as svn, is open source version control system used for storing the historical changes of source file and documents and manages it over a period of time this post helps you to setup svn on linux mint 19 linux mint 18 install webserver. Learn more about visualsvn integration for visual studio. Install the subversion, apache2 and libapache2 svn packages. Install apache svn subversion on debian 9 subversion revision.
Obviously not the fault of aptget for example, downloading java isnt aptget install java. The linux installation process automatically creates an etcinit. Installing and configuring an apache subversion svn. Apart from it, you also need to download and install the command line client on your machine. Tutorial to download, compile, setup and run vega strike downloading vega strike installing svn.
The site will be decommissioned and shut down on 1july2020. Subversion is developed as a project of the apache software foundation, and as such is part of a rich. Apache subversionsvn can be easily downloaded and installed with the use of the commandline. Installing subversion users of debian and debianbased distributions like ubuntu just need to issue the following command. Oct 31, 2019 the goal of the subversion project is to build a version control system that is a compelling replacement for cvs in the open source community. This tutorial covers the installation, configuration and administration of a linux subversion server and trac server. Create an svn directory, at the root of your system for example. Wandiscos subversion binaries provide a complete, fullytested version of subversion based on the most recent stable release, including the latest fixes, and undergo the same rigorous quality assurance process that wandisco uses for its enterprise products supporting the worlds largest subversion implementations. Upon successful login, the content will be listed like below.
It helps you keep track of a collection of files and folders. This starts the server when you start up your system. Apache subversion enterpriseclass centralized version control for the masses welcome to subversion. How to install collabnet svn on linux pawankumar83s blog. Centos linux debian linux fedora linux freebsd hpux netbsd openbsd. Create a configuration file on d configurations folder for svn.
Subversion began with a cvs paradigm and supports all the major features of cvs, but has evolved to support many features that cvs users often wish they had. These issues affect subversion svnserve servers only. Windows, linux, all flavors of bsd, mac os x, netware, and others. When you would like to download the new files created by your team members, or the files which were changed by them you will issue. Red hat enterprise linux es and as release 4 32 bit file system. Download installers and virtual machines, or run your own subversion server in the cloud subversion svn is an open source scm that enjoys widespread adoption in organizations around the world. Jul 10, 20 subversion is an alternative to cvs that is growing in popularity. This is a simple standalone server which comes with the subversion release. Simply the coolest interface to subversion control. Bitnami subversion stack installers bitnami native installers automate the setup of a bitnami application stack on windows, mac os and linux. Installing and configuring an apache subversion svn server. Installing and configuring an apache subversion svn server 6.
If you plan to have multiple repositories, you should have a group dedicated to each repository for ease of administration. Subversion, also known as svn, an opensource version control system. It also integrates the popular viewvc repository browsing tool so that users can view repository history from a web browser. The apache subversion project only distributes source code, but a number of third parties provide binary packages for a number of platforms. Svn client, subversion client, download, windows, linux, macos, os x. I do not need to work with svn after this, i just need to download all the files onto my system in one go instead of right click and saving each of them. View the readme, and make sure to read the postinstallation instructions for configuration of the client. Any time you change, add or delete a file or folder that you manage with subversion, you commit these changes to your subversion repository, which creates a new revision in your repository reflecting these changes. Apache subversion or as it is normally called, svn, is a software versioning. Introduction to collabnet svn collabnet subversion edge includes everything you need to install, manage and operate a subversion server. This is a commercial svn subversion client for linux, windows and mac operating systems. Subversion svn is an open source scm that enjoys widespread adoption in organizations around the world.
Installing and configuring subversion for version control. Install the subversion, apache2 and libapache2svn packages. I have read several howto guides, but i havent been able to find. Nov 22, 2017 install apache svn subversion on debian 9 subversion authentication. It stores the historic source codes, documents, and web pages. For the testing phase, ill use 2 different client machines. The red book has been unhelpful at least to me on linux. Instantly host your subversion repositories with collabnet cloudforge. Its intuitive and easy to use, since it doesnt require the subversion command line client to run.
Intellij idea comes bundled with the subversion plugin. Subversion svn is a version control software that allows users to download the very latest version of a branch, without having to wait for someone to get. Each installer includes all of the software necessary to run out of the box the stack. Install apache svn subversion on debian 9 ubuntu 16. Apache subversion is an open source revision controlling program. Upon successful login, contents will be listed as below. Webclient for svn is the web interface for subversion svn. As linux client, we need to install the subversion package to connect to the svn repository. Install apache subversion on centos 8 rhel 8 linux. This command will download all the changes in the repository including deletions thats it, lets take action. Run the following commands to install svn on centos 8 rhel 8 linux machine. Subversion is an alternative to cvs that is growing in popularity. My current issues come with not knowing howwhere linux program install to, and the permissions needed to run software there. How to install and configure apache subversionsvn in linux.
The software allows you to perform the most common version control operations directly from inside the microsoft visual studio ide. Aug 11, 2018 install apache svn on linux mint 19 apache svn authentication. It is used to checkout, update, delete, export and import changes done on the modules in to the server repository. Svn command line tutorial linux windows subversion. Type svn version to see the program version and ra modules or svn version quiet to see just the version number.
In ubuntu and debian, i guess it is easy to install subversion just by using the synaptic package manager adept for kubuntu. To start the service manually, run the following command. Download installers and virtual machines, or run your own subversion server in the cloud. And it is free to use, even in a commercial environment. Create the svn user and group with the following commands. This assumes you want to install into the toolbox folder. Apache subversion is a commandline software similar to the git or bazaar version control systems. Visualsvn for visual studio 2015 and older includes apache subversion 1. This file is used to specify defaults for different svn commands. Im already very familiar with subversion on windows.
Subversion is an open source version control system. Svn is an open source software tool, which acts as a server repository for storing and managing the files and directories. Intellij idea currently supports integration with subversion 1. The easiest way to get subversion is to download a binary package built for your. Download a file from an svn repository stack overflow. Subversion is a version control system that keeps track of changes made to.
Install subversion by running the following commands. The bitnami subversion stack provides a oneclick install solution for subversion. Free subversion edge download collabnet versionone. The goal of the subversion project is to build a version control system that is a compelling replacement for cvs in the open source community.
With the subversion integration enabled, you can perform basic subversion operations from inside intellij idea. You must register svnserve with the service manager. It is used to keep track of source file and documents. How to install svn server on rhelcentos and fedora linux.